reflect for a moment on what America went through with Hurricane Katrina, reflect on what it has meant to our country and what it has meant to our Government. That was the greatest natural disaster of modern time. Americans were shaken to the core watching television night after night to see victims of Hurricane Katrina and what they were living through. Many of those scenes we witnessed did not look like America. It just doesn't seem like our great Nation where people would be in such a helpless and almost hopeless state--to find people struggling just to survive the floodwaters and the hurricane damage, to see Americans begging for water and food, to see what appeared to be refugees--in fact, evacuees--trying to bring their children across interstate bridges to dry land, to see people thrown in many different directions, families divided and still not united. To see all of that occur day in and day out 24-7 was a startling scene. It was an indication to all of us that we needed to take a step back and take a look at America from a different angle. Perhaps too many of us had been lulled into the belief that this sort of thing could never happen, that leaders in America would never let us reach this terrible point, whether it is a natural disaster or a terrorist disaster, that someone somewhere in Washington or in a State capital or in a city hall had not made preparations and plans to deal with it.…
